I updated my Windows 10 for you and I now have the newest Version available to me (Version 20H2 OS build 19042.867). They changed the settings and I had the problem again, but i was able to fix it:
Go to: Settings - System - Sound - Device properties (from Output) - Additional device properties (located on the right side). Then go to Tab "Enhancements" and check the box "Disable all enhancements". The go to Tab "Advanced" and uncheck the box "Give exclusive mode applications priority".
After that restart the application you want to use as a music player (if it is currently running). After that I had no sound issues with my music anymore.
